Transaction 523d5da80b108df8d811cb2275ad716afefc33c074a1df2975c7dd26c7728568

3 Input
2 Outputs
  • 523d5da80b108df8d811cb2275ad716afefc33c074a1df2975c7dd26c7728568:0
  • value  125452000
    address  16FgQXGzSLRtdwuwCN7mcaPUtbJ6JFTkVw
  • 523d5da80b108df8d811cb2275ad716afefc33c074a1df2975c7dd26c7728568:1
  • value  1478426
    address  1AifQdbRiRbq2gT9Wdqj3NZQ7i9T4umaZy